Analysis of Monetary Policy and Financial Stability: A New Paradigm

Abstract

This paper introduces agent heterogeneity, liquidity, and endogenous default to a DSGE framework. Our model allows for a comprehensive assessment of regulatory and monetary policy, as well as welfare analysis in the different sectors of the economy.
